A 40s-50s Japanese souvenir jacket
A sukajan (souvenir jacket) from the 1940s-50s with no padding, featuring special embroidery on both sides.
Side A depicts a striking scene of an eagle clutching a continent designed to resemble the American flag. The front features embroidered tigers and dragons, creating a magnificent design that blends Japanese and American motifs.
Side B features a dynamic full-body dragon, complemented by two eagles on the front, also creating an impactful design.
Both sides feature "OKINAWA" embroidered in two colors, indicating a custom-made, one-of-a-kind piece.
This is a rare and popular vintage sukajan without padding, making it suitable for wear year-round. While some damage is visible, it is in good condition for a sukajan of its age and retains its original charm.
